Default VW Bug Sounding LS1?!?!

Okay, I picked up my car today from the mechanic. I was so happy to get it back, I didn't even do the normal fine tooth comb bit when I got it back, just blasted back to SD w/ some good tunes for the first time in almost a month. Well, once I calmed down a bit, I noticed that whenever I'm giving it ANY throttle, I'm hearing a VW bug engine sound. It sounds like it's comming from the left side of the car. Anybody ever hear of this before? Thanks.

Default

Sounds like an exhaust leak. Check to be sure that they tightened the header on after the gasket install.

Default

You can do it yourself. Check out the gasket though. If you have a bad exhaust leak it burns the gasket up. I've burned two collector gasket from the bolts loosening up. Now I use lock washers.
